Holistic Medical Treatment of body, mind and soul
Holistic Medical Treatments are practiced all over the world as part of the local traditional medicine systems which we find in every old culture. In western countries these treatments are regarded as an alternative for allopathic medicine treatments. The term „holistic“ relates to the philosophy, that every being and everything is energetically connected with each other. We are connected with the nature, our planet and even with the stars and planets in our universe.
In Holistic Medicine body, mind and soul of a being are seen as an unit. Therefore the treatment of a symptom or a disease includes the therapy of body, mind and soul same time. Holistic Medical Treatment is focussed on healing the root causes and on activation of the selfhealing power of the body. Medicines are mainly natural, like herbs and spices or minerals, but even a walk in the fresh air or sunbathing is considered as medicine.
Integration of Holistic Medical Treatments
The approach of Holistic Medicine is as old as humanity. Our early ancestors understood, to treat diseases or complaints with all nature has to offer. Later in high cultures like ancient India, China, Egypt, Persia or Mesopotamia, extensive Holistic Health Care systems were developed. The main concern in these systems is the prevention of diseases. This requires a lifestyle in alignment with one’s own nature and the environment, including healthy food and activities in daily life, which bring health and happiness to the body, mind and soul.
In the last 15-20 years this kind of preventive lifestyle got very popular in western countries, especially because of the limits of allopathic medicine in treating chronic diseases. Many people are interested and learn from cultures and indigenous people, who are still living a natural holistic lifestyle like in India, China, Japan or South America. Popular methods and Holistic Medical Systems
The most popular holistic medical systems are Yoga, Ayurveda, TCM (Traditional Chinese Medicine), European Naturopathy, Hypnosis or Homeopathy with healing and preventive effects. More and more physicians all over the world are learning and practicing the principles and methods of these Holistic Medicine Systems. They offer treatments with herbal medicine and detox cures, acupuncture and acupressure or physical and mental exercises and even meditation.
